Server shuts down after warm boot

After warm booting the server, the OS begins to load and just before Windows appears (after Starting up... completes), the server will completely shut down. As if the power cables were both disconnected. This server has dual PIII 500 Xeon processors and 2GB RAM. Please advise soonest. Win2K Advanced Server SP 1 installed. Compaq Smartstart 4.9 with Cmpq Management 4.9 installed.

Re: Server shuts down after warm boot

I to have the same problem. I installed Windows 2000 Advance Server with SP1 and it ran fine. Until this morning when I rebooted the machine. Now I cannot get it to boot normally or in safe mode. However, I have another installation of advance server installed and can boot fine. Did a boot logging and am finding a lot of Compaq utilities are not loading. I know it is not related to power supply since I have three. Not related to fans since all of them are working. Not related to CPU's since they have been checked and are working fine.

Where does this lead me to, back to Compaq drivers no loading. So you may need to look at the boot log file to see. As for me, I may be having to re-install since Compaq told me to look at the fans first.

Re: Server shuts down after warm boot

Some (but not all) Compaq 7000 P43 System BIOS machines only are said to experience this problem. If yours does, please request SP16340 RomPAQ update from Compaq.
Ayman Altounji
Valued Contributor

Re: Server shuts down after warm boot

Thanks, Rheim! SP16340 worked like a charm. Too bad the Compaq support engineers couldn't have told me about this a little earlier..
